I have the half aluminum/half steel 3000 lb. jack from Craftsman. I paid something like $80 for it. I needed it because it was the only jack I could find for a reasonable price that would fit under my 951. (My 4000 lb. Craftsman jack was too tall in the down position.)
Here's the one I have. Very high quality. I had to wait until it was on sale.
